How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bakersfield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bakersfield Studio Apartments | $1,093 | $800 | $1,469 |
| Bakersfield 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,448 | $772 | $2,030 |
| Bakersfield 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,700 | $899 | $2,420 |
| Bakersfield 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,005 | $1,000 | $2,695 |
| Bakersfield 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,104 | $1,374 | $2,699 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bakersfield
How much are Studio apartments in Bakersfield?
There are currently 157 Studio Apartments in Bakersfield with rent ranges from $800 to $1,469 with an average price of $1,093.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bakersfield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bakersfield ranges from $772 to $2,030 with an average monthly rent of $1,448.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bakersfield c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bakersfield range from $899 to $2,420.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,700.
How expensive are Bakersfield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 393 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Bakersfield on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,000 to $2,695 - averaging $2,005 for the location.
